Title

Productivity and Quality Propagation Modeling in Battery Manufacturing

Abstract
Finite fossil fuels and the need for reduced carbon dioxide emissions have led to an increase in battery electric vehicle sales. To meet the demand of this steadily growing industry segment, large amounts of battery cells are required. Therefore, large-scale battery cell manufacturing has become a major part in the pursuit of a sustainable transportation sector. However, battery manufacturing is a complex procedure and there are multiple challenges that have to be solved in order to provide a high productivity and quality. The implementation of digital tools in the battery manufacturing lines can support these aims. Additionally, this chapter proposes a quality flow model and derived mathematical equations for the optimization of a serial battery manufacturing line with inspection and repairing stations.
